Setting the user password restricts who can boot the computer. The password
prompt will be displayed before the computer is booted. If only the supervisor
password is set, the computer boots without asking for a password. If both
passwords are set, the user can enter either password to boot the computer.
For enhanced security, use different passwords for the supervisor and user
passwords.
Valid password characters are A-Z, a-z, and 0-9. Passwords may be up to
19 characters in length.

If no password is set, any user can change all Setup options.
NOTE
The BIOS complies with NIST Special Publication 800-147 BIOS Protection Guidelines /
Recommendations of the National Institute of Standards and Technology. Refer to
http://csrc.nist.gov/publications/nistpubs/800-147/NIST-SP800-147-April2011.pdf
more information.
